الفرق بين المراجعتين ل"Ruby/Time/isdst"
اذهب إلى التنقل
اذهب إلى البحث
(أنشأ الصفحة ب'<noinclude>{{DISPLAYTITLE: التابع <code>isdst</code> الخاص بالصنف <code>Time</code> في روبي}}</noinclude> تصنيف: Ruby تصنيف:...') |
|||
سطر 3: | سطر 3: | ||
[[تصنيف: Ruby Method]] | [[تصنيف: Ruby Method]] | ||
[[تصنيف: Ruby Time]] | [[تصنيف: Ruby Time]] | ||
− | يُعيد التابع <code>isdst</code> القيمة <code>true</code> إن وقع [[Ruby/Time|التوقيت]] | + | يُعيد التابع <code>isdst</code> القيمة <code>true</code> إن وقع [[Ruby/Time|التوقيت]] الذي استُدعي معه أثناء التوقيت الصيفي<code>[[Ruby/Time|Time]]</code> في منطقته الزمنية. |
==البنية العامة== | ==البنية العامة== | ||
<syntaxhighlight lang="ruby">isdst → true or false</syntaxhighlight> | <syntaxhighlight lang="ruby">isdst → true or false</syntaxhighlight> | ||
==القيمة المُعادة== | ==القيمة المُعادة== | ||
+ | يُعيد التابع <code>isdst</code> القيمة <code>true</code> إن وقع [[Ruby/Time|التوقيت]] الذي استُدعي معه أثناء التوقيت الصيفي<code>[[Ruby/Time|Time]]</code> في منطقته الزمنية. خلا ذلك سيعيد <code>flase</code>. | ||
+ | |||
==أمثلة== | ==أمثلة== | ||
مثال على استخدام التابع <code>isdst</code>: | مثال على استخدام التابع <code>isdst</code>: | ||
سطر 24: | سطر 26: | ||
Time.local(2000, 7, 1).dst? #=> false</syntaxhighlight> | Time.local(2000, 7, 1).dst? #=> false</syntaxhighlight> | ||
==انظر أيضا== | ==انظر أيضا== | ||
− | * التابع <code>[[Ruby/Time/inspect|inspect]]</code>: يُعيد التابع <code>inspect</code> [[Ruby/String|سلسلة نصية]] تمثل [[Ruby/Time|التوقيت]] | + | * التابع <code>[[Ruby/Time/inspect|inspect]]</code>: يُعيد التابع <code>inspect</code> [[Ruby/String|سلسلة نصية]] تمثل [[Ruby/Time|التوقيت]]. |
− | * التابع <code>[[Ruby/Time/localtime|localtime]]</code>: يحول التابع <code>localtime</code> [[Ruby/Time|التوقيت]] <code>time</code> إلى التوقيت المحلي | + | * التابع <code>[[Ruby/Time/localtime|localtime]]</code>: يحول التابع <code>localtime</code> [[Ruby/Time|التوقيت]] <code>time</code> إلى التوقيت المحلي. |
==مصادر== | ==مصادر== | ||
*[http://ruby-doc.org/core-2.5.1/Time.html#method-i-isdst قسم التابع isdst في الصنف Time في توثيق روبي الرسمي.] | *[http://ruby-doc.org/core-2.5.1/Time.html#method-i-isdst قسم التابع isdst في الصنف Time في توثيق روبي الرسمي.] |
مراجعة 14:30، 7 نوفمبر 2018
يُعيد التابع isdst
القيمة true
إن وقع التوقيت الذي استُدعي معه أثناء التوقيت الصيفيTime
في منطقته الزمنية.
البنية العامة
isdst → true or false
القيمة المُعادة
يُعيد التابع isdst
القيمة true
إن وقع التوقيت الذي استُدعي معه أثناء التوقيت الصيفيTime
في منطقته الزمنية. خلا ذلك سيعيد flase
.
أمثلة
مثال على استخدام التابع isdst
:
# CST6CDT:
Time.local(2000, 1, 1).zone #=> "CST"
Time.local(2000, 1, 1).isdst #=> false
Time.local(2000, 1, 1).dst? #=> false
Time.local(2000, 7, 1).zone #=> "CDT"
Time.local(2000, 7, 1).isdst #=> true
Time.local(2000, 7, 1).dst? #=> true
# Asia/Tokyo:
Time.local(2000, 1, 1).zone #=> "JST"
Time.local(2000, 1, 1).isdst #=> false
Time.local(2000, 1, 1).dst? #=> false
Time.local(2000, 7, 1).zone #=> "JST"
Time.local(2000, 7, 1).isdst #=> false
Time.local(2000, 7, 1).dst? #=> false
انظر أيضا
- التابع
inspect
: يُعيد التابعinspect
سلسلة نصية تمثل التوقيت. - التابع
localtime
: يحول التابعlocaltime
التوقيتtime
إلى التوقيت المحلي.